A park made up of... parks
The Santa Monica Mountains Recreation National Recreation Area provides car rental Santa Monica travelers with oodles of outdoor opportunities. That's because it's comprised of not one, not two, not even five state parks. The Santa Monica Mountains NRA includes six California State Parks, and was intended as an extension to the Channel Islands National (Underwater) Park. While visiting the NRA, car rental Santa Monica customers are encouraged to stop by the Topanga State Park, Malibu Creek State Park, Point Mugu State Park and Will Rogers State Historic Park. You can also catch some rays at the Point Dume State Beach and along the trails at Leo Carrillo State Park.
Scientific and environmental information
The Santa Monica Mountains National Recreation Area is home to one of the largest protected Mediterranean-type ecosystems in the world. A large part of what is referred to as the Mediterranean Coast Network, which include the Channel Islands National Park and the Cabrillo Monument, the Santa Monica Mountains NRA supports over 1,000 different plant species and approximately 500 mammal, bird, reptilian and amphibian species. So what exactly is characteristic of a Mediterranean ecosystem? Well, car rental Santa Monica travelers will notice drought deciduous scrublands, mild rainy winter weather and warm, dry summer heat.

Find your way to the National Park Visitor Center
The best place to begin your car rental Santa Monica trip to the Santa Monica Mountain NRA is at the National Park Visitor Center on Hillcrest Drive. To get there from the Ventura Freeway, exit onto Lynn Road heading north. When you get to Hillcrest Drive, turn east, and then hang a left onto McCloud Avenue. The parking lot for the National Park Visitor Center will be on the right. If you're on the 23 Freeway, exit at the Thousand Oaks Boulevard/Hillcrest Drive ext going west onto Hillcrest. Turn right onto McCloud and the parking lot will be right there.
The Santa Monica Mountains National Recreation Area is open daily from 9am to 5pm. For more information on hours and activities, car rental Santa Monica customers can call 1-805-370-2301.
